Some common eating disorders are anorexia nervosa, bulimia nervosa, and binge eating … WebResearchers found that people who are currently suffering from anorexia have significantly lower levels of serotonin metabolites in their cerebrospinal fluid than individuals without aneating disorder. This is likely a sign of starvation, since the body synthesizes serotonin from the food we eat. bus pre trip inspection class b https://hypnauticyacht.com
